Step-by-Step Guide to Customizing Your Lock Screen Widgets
1. Access Your Lock Screen Customization Options
To begin customizing your lock screen widgets:
- Wake up your device and press and hold the lock screen for a few seconds until you see the “Customize” option.
- Tap on “Customize” to enter the lock screen editing mode.
2. Choose Your Layout
The lock screen interface allows for multiple widgets. You can opt for a simple or adorned design depending on your preferences.
- Tap the clock area to bring up different fonts and color options.
- Select a style that compliments your aesthetic while remaining readable.
3. Add Widgets to Your Lock Screen
Adding widgets is where the customization truly shines:
- Scroll down to the widget area below the clock.
- Tap “Add Widgets” to explore the list of available widgets. iOS 17 supports a wide variety of widgets from Apple’s native apps as well as third-party applications.
- Find the widgets you wish to include and simply tap on them to add.
4. Rearrange and Resize Widgets
After selecting your desired widgets, you may want to rearrange them or change their sizes.
- Press and hold the widget to drag it around the lock screen.
- If a widget has multiple size options, you can tap on it to view the alternatives. Resize them based on the amount of information you want to be displayed.
5. Fine-Tune Your Widget Settings
Many widgets come with additional settings for personalization:
- Some weather widgets let you adjust the location settings, while calendar widgets can display specific calendars or adjust event previews.
- Explore widget configurations through the app settings for a tailored experience.
6. Preview and Save Your Custom Lock Screen
Once you’re satisfied with the look and functionality of your lock screen:
- Tap the “Done” button in the upper right corner to preview your new design.
- If everything looks great, tap “Set as Wallpaper Pair” or “Set Lock Screen” to save your changes.
Considerations for Choosing Your Widgets
When customizing your lock screen, it’s essential to curate your widget selection thoughtfully:
- Prioritize Functionality: Choose widgets that provide you with the information you need at a glance. For example, if you’re an avid runner, a fitness tracker widget might be indispensable.
- Stay Aware of Privacy: Consider what information you want visible on your lock screen. Avoid including sensitive data that can be accessed easily.
- Balance Aesthetics and Usability: Ensure that your design is both functional and visually appealing. A cluttered lock screen can be overwhelming, so choose a fewer number of well-placed widgets.
